SPRights enumeration
NOTE: This API is now obsolete.
Especifica os direitos que se aplicam aos usuários, grupos de sites e grupos intersites.
This enumeration has a FlagsAttribute attribute that allows a bitwise combination of its member values.
Namespace: Microsoft.SharePoint
Assembly: Microsoft.SharePoint (in Microsoft.SharePoint.dll)
Syntax
'Declaração
<ObsoleteAttribute("Use SPBasePermissions instead")> _
<FlagsAttribute> _
Public Enumeration SPRights
'Uso
Dim instance As SPRights
[ObsoleteAttribute("Use SPBasePermissions instead")]
[FlagsAttribute]
public enum SPRights
Members
Member name | Description | |
---|---|---|
EmptyMask | Obsolete. Valor: 0x00000000. Não tem permissões no site da Web. Não está disponível por meio da interface do usuário. Grupos: n/d. | |
ViewListItems | Obsolete. Valor: 0x00000001. Exibir itens em listas, documentos em bibliotecas de documentos e comentários de discussão na Web. Grupos: Leitor, colaborador, Web Designer, administrador. | |
AddListItems | Obsolete. Valor: 0x00000002. Adicionar itens a listas, adicionar documentos a bibliotecas de documentos e comentários de discussão na Web. Grupos: Colaborador, Web Designer, administrador. | |
EditListItems | Obsolete. Valor: 0x00000004. Edite itens em listas, editar documentos em bibliotecas de documentos, editar comentários de discussões na Web em documentos e personalizar páginas de Web Parts em bibliotecas de documentos. Grupos: Colaborador, Web Designer, administrador. | |
DeleteListItems | Obsolete. Valor: 0x00000008. Exclua itens de uma lista, documentos de uma biblioteca de documentos e comentários de discussões na Web em documentos. Grupos: Colaborador, WebDesigner, administrador. | |
CancelCheckout | Obsolete. Valor: 0x00000100. Check-in de um documento sem salvar as alterações atuais. Grupos: WebDesigner, administrador. | |
ManagePersonalViews | Obsolete. Valor: 0x00000200. Criar, alterar e excluir exibições pessoais de listas. Grupos: Colaborador, WebDesigner, administrador. | |
ManageListPermissions | Obsolete. Não é mais usado. | |
ManageLists | Obsolete. Valor: 0x00000800. Criar e excluir listas, adicionar ou remover colunas em uma lista e adicionar ou remover exibições públicas de uma lista. Grupos: WebDesigner, administrador. | |
AnonymousSearchAccessList | Obsolete. Verifique o conteúdo de uma lista ou biblioteca de documentos retrieveable para usuários anônimos por meio de pesquisa do SharePoint. Não alteram as permissões de lista no site. | |
AnonymousSearchAccessWebLists | Obsolete. Conteúdo de listas e bibliotecas de documentos no site serão recuperável para usuários anônimos por meio de pesquisa do SharePoint se a lista ou biblioteca de documentos tem AnonymousSearchAccessList definido. | |
OpenWeb | Obsolete. Valor: 0x00010000. Permitir que os usuários abram um site, uma lista ou uma pasta. Grupos: Convidado, leitor, colaborador, WebDesigner, administrador. | |
ViewPages | Obsolete. Valor: 0x00020000. Exibir páginas em um site da Web. Grupos: Leitor, colaborador, WebDesigner, administrador. | |
AddAndCustomizePages | Obsolete. Valor: 0x00040000. Adicionar, alterar, ou excluir páginas HTML ou páginas de Web Parts e editar o site usando um editor do Windows SharePoint Services – compatível com. Grupos: WebDesigner, administrador. | |
ApplyThemeAndBorder | Obsolete. Valor: 0x00080000. Aplica um tema ou bordas ao site inteiro. Grupos: Web Designer, administrador. | |
ApplyStyleSheets | Obsolete. Valor: 0x00100000. Aplica uma folha de estilo (arquivo. CSS) ao site da Web. Grupos: WebDesigner, administrador. | |
ViewUsageData | Obsolete. Valor: 0x00200000. Exibir relatórios sobre o uso do site. Grupos: administrador. | |
CreateSSCSite | Obsolete. Valor: 0x00400000. Crie um site usando a criação de Site Pessoal. Grupos: Leitor, colaborador, Web Designer, administrador. | |
ManageSubwebs | Obsolete. Valor: 0x00800000. Crie subsites como sites de equipe, sites de espaço de trabalho de reunião e sites de espaço de trabalho de documento. Grupos: administrador. | |
CreatePersonalGroups | Obsolete. Valor: 0x01000000. Crie um grupo de usuários que podem ser usados em qualquer lugar dentro do conjunto de sites. Grupos: administrador. | |
ManageRoles | Obsolete. Valor: 0x02000000. Criar, alterar e excluir grupos de sites, incluindo adicionam usuários aos grupos de sites e specifyi os direitos atribuídos a um grupo de sites. Grupos: administrador. | |
BrowseDirectories | Obsolete. Valor: 0x04000000. Enumere arquivos e pastas em um site usando interfaces de Web DAV e Microsoft Office SharePoint Designer 2007 . Grupos: Colaborador, WebDesigner, administrador. | |
BrowseUserInfo | Obsolete. Valor: 0x08000000. Exibir informações sobre usuários do site. Convidado, leitor, colaborador, Web Designer, administrador. | |
AddDelPrivateWebParts | Obsolete. Valor: 0x10000000. Adicionar ou remover Web Parts pessoais em uma Web Part. Grupos: Colaborador, WebDesigner, administrador. | |
UpdatePersonalWebParts | Obsolete. Valor: 0x20000000. Atualize Web Parts para exibir informações individualizadas. Grupos: Colaborador, WebDesigner, administrador. | |
ManageWeb | Obsolete. Valor: 0x40000000. Gerencie um site, incluindo a capacidade de executar todas as tarefas de administração do site e gerenciar conteúdos e permissões. Grupos: administrador. | |
FullMask | Obsolete. Valor: -1. Tem todas as permissões no site da Web. Não está disponível por meio da interface do usuário. Grupos: n/d. |
Comentários
Uma permissão consiste em um direito ou a combinação de direitos conforme especificado pela enumeração SPRights . Cada permissão dentro da coleção de permissões para um site ou lista é representada por um objeto SPPermission , cuja propriedade PermissionMask contém o conjunto de direitos atribuídos ao usuário ou ao grupo.
Ao contrário dos direitos como usado na interface do usuário, direitos não dependem de outros direitos no modelo de objeto. Direitos individuais podem ser atribuídos a usuários e grupos, sem incluir direitos dependentes e podem ser atribuídos em qualquer combinação. Tenha cuidado ao personalizar permissões por meio do modelo de objeto, como atribuir um direito único para um usuário ou grupo, por exemplo, pode produzir uma experiência de usuário desagradáveis.
Para obter informações sobre grupos de sites que estão disponíveis por padrão, consulte a enumeração SPRoleType . Para obter informações gerais sobre segurança e permissões, consulte Security, Users, and Groups in Windows SharePoint Services.